Continue ReadingWe’re highlighting some of the best offensive performances from the Jackson area from this past Friday.
Isaiah Grybauskas Isaiah Grybauskas 6'1" | 185 lbs | QB Jackson Northwest | 2022 MI – Northwest – QB – 6’1″ 194 lbs
Friday was my first time coming across Grybauskas and he did not disappoint. He’s a fantastic athlete and runs all over the defense. He’s able to make most throws and is good on the run. He had 250 scrimmage yards on the night. He added 125-yards and 2 TDs on the ground. He kept the defense honest all night and caught them lacking a few times.
Andrew Cheney – Vandercook – RB – 5’10″ 160 lbs
Cheney put on a clinic on Friday as he helped Vandercook blowout Webberville. I don’t think Cheney was ever actually tackled on the night. He either ran out of bounds or found the endzone. He had 224 rushing yards and 3 TDs on the night. He only had 8 carries too. Anytime he touched the ball something magic happened and he should be the focal point of the offense.
Colin Morrow Colin Morrow 5'11" | 195 lbs | ATH Jackson Lumen Christi | 2022 MI – Lumen Christi – RB – 5’11″ 180 lbs
Morrow was all over Dearborn on Friday and there wasn’t much they could do to stop him. He broke a long TD early in the game. He shot through the A-gap, broke a tackle, and hit the gas. He hit the endzone and put Lumen up 7-0. He put up just under 175 scrimmage yards on the night and had his TD on the way to an easy win.
Mekhi Wingfield – Concord – WR – 6’3″ 180 lbs
Wingfield is only a sophomore and is starting to dominate. Over the past few weeks, the light has really clicked and he’s started making big plays. He has a big frame and is able to go up and come down with those contested catches. He doesn’t run a pretty route tree yet, but he’ll get there. He put up 8 receptions, 75-yards, and a Touchdown on the night. Just the beginning for someone who has a massive presence on the field.
